Output 08ffbae289011f8cd99c9226597a2f7af17f0831f5c2cc15ac541cf2a797a853:16

value
10555551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db72fdedbc5c11a6a5339559ff4cc6d1739178f0 OP_EQUAL
address
3MhMfLEpMmY24o1izHxngt8cX7Rc1sWbWT
transaction
08ffbae289011f8cd99c9226597a2f7af17f0831f5c2cc15ac541cf2a797a853
confirmations
326659
spent
true